Seattle-based Alaska Airlines recently shared an article on its blog, in which it committed to “becoming the most accessible and inclusive airline for everyone.” To highlight its commitment, the airline released a new video to celebrate National Disability Employment Awareness Month.
The company stated, “We recognize that our diversity and inclusion efforts MUST include people with disabilities to positively impact the lives of ALL our employees and passengers.” That’s a refreshing take, given how frequently disability is left out of DE&I initiatives.
“We’ve come a long way in terms of helping our employees and customers with disabilities, but we didn’t do that alone. We rely heavily on our disability partnerships to let us know where we need to go to improve,” said Ray Prentice, Director of Customer Advocacy, Alaska Airlines.
